ISBN10: 0345350685, ISBN13: 9780345350688, [publisher: Ballantine Books] Softcover A testament of great emotional power, the book presents the Malcolm X that very few knew, the man behind the stereotyped firebrand - a sensitive, proud, highly intelligent man who passionately and lucidly articulated the struggle and the beliefs of African Americans in the 1960s. Cut short by the riddle of assassins' bullets, Malcolm X held the preminition that he would not live long enough to see this book appear. It is,in its dead level honesty, an established classic of modern America. 'The most important book I'll ever read. It changed the way I thought; it changed the way I acted' - Spike Lee.
